What does an advertising creative director do?

As a creative director, you’ll be responsible for the big picture, recruiting and managing staff across multiple advertising campaigns and ensuring work produced is of a high standard, enhancing the agency’s reputation.

You’ll get to use your creative abilities along with your project management and communication skills to develop ideas while working with different people. You may have to negotiate contracts and be a salesperson for your company.

It's a competitive area that requires dedication and hard work. You’ll have to meet lots of deadlines and keep clients happy. However, the creative and teamwork aspects of the role can make it hugely rewarding, along with the potential for high salaries, fast job progression and international opportunities.

What will your days involve?

Daily tasks will vary but could involve:

  • Managing a portfolio of client accounts and related activities
  • Overseeing entire projects and taking responsibility for the creative process
  • Winning new clients for your company
  • Meeting with clients to talk about their needs
  • Informing clients about the progress of their campaigns
  • Keeping records of meetings and actions required
  • Gathering data to support the development of a campaign
  • Preparing information and materials for presenting ideas and costs
  • Producing sketches and storyboards of ideas and pitching these to clients
  • Instructing and monitoring the creative team that produces the campaigns
  • Hiring creatives like copywriters, artists, photographers or graphic designers
  • Finding locations for photo and film shoots
  • Ensuring that briefs, deadlines and budgets are met

What's an advertising creative director salary?

The average salary for an advertising creative director in the UK is £41,600.

Does an advertising creative director role involve travel in the UK or overseas?

As a creative director you’ll travel for work often either to an office, to see a client or to attend industry events and exhibitions. Overseas travel may be involved if you work for a larger agency.

Can you work from home as an advertising creative director?

As a creative director there may be some opportunities to work from home, but you’ll want to touch base with your teams frequently to support them and check on progress.
